The Ohio Environmental Protection Agency has issued a statewide Air Quality Advisory for the entire state of Ohio as smoke from Canadian wildfires continues to adversely impact air quality.
Pollutants across the state are expected to range from the 'Unhealthy For Sensitive Groups' category in the southwest part of the state to the 'Unhealthy' category in the rest of the state. Hourly concentrations at times may reach the 'Very Unhealthy' to 'Hazardous' categories.
It is recommended, when possible, to avoid strenuous outdoor activities, especially those with heart disease and respiratory conditions like asthma. Watch for symptoms including wheezing, coughing, chest tightness, dizziness, or burning in the nose, throat, and eyes.

Sales funds to assist Celina Lake Festival
Photo by William Kincaid/The Daily Standard

Several people on Thursday evening rummage through items at the Celina Lake Festival garage sale, filling up small bags for $3 and large boxes for $5. The sale, located at 715 S. Sugar St. (former Case Leasing building), continues today until 5 p.m. and Saturday from 9 a.m. to noon. All proceeds benefit the festival's fireworks fund.
